The Liki Tiki Village is located just seven miles from the Walt Disney Resort entrance in Kissimmee, Florida. It's a 64-acre gated community close to the Orlando International Airport with easy access to the city of Orlando. Here guests can choose from over 3,800 dining facilities, 125 area golf courses and over 44 million square feet of shopping, miniature golf, natural wonders and cultural and sporting events.
One bedroom condos are equipped with, One queen bed, Double sofa bed in living/dining room along with two cushioned wicker chairs, coffee table, and four-chair dining set. Balcony or patio with dining set. 600-square-foot interior, TV in bedroom, TV with DVD player in living/dining room. Kitchen with four-burner range, microwave, refrigerator, and dishwasher. Jetted tub and stacked washer/dryer.
Two bedroom condos are equipped with, One king bed in master bedroom and two twin beds in second bedroom, One queen sofa bed in living/dining room along with two cushioned wicker chairs, coffee table, and six-chair dining set. Balcony or patio with dining set. 1,300-square-foot interior. TV in master bedroom. Large TV with DVD player in living/dining room. Kitchen with four-burner range, microwave, refrigerator, dishwasher, and three-stool breakfast bar. Jetted tub and shower in master bathroom. Shower/tub combination in second bathroom and full-sized washer/dryer.

The property was average to the other similar properties we have stayed at. The pool heaters on two of the three pools were out for a day while we were there. There was a raccoon in the trash one night because one side of the property didn't have a fence. We also observed two opossums on the property. The property doesn't offer any free internet service. The bed sheet didn't fit the pull out couch properly. Two shots and one beer cost $20 at the bar (Shipwreck Sally's) on site. The property was also short on pool loungers. The property needs to be cleaned up in general. The staff was friendly though and our one bedroom unit was clean. I would not stay at this property again unless I had young children along that would use the water park..

We booked the room with 2 double beds, however upon check in we were informed that the second bed is only a sofa bed which was very very uncomfortable with very bad springs which digs into your back.
The second issue is the the front lobby looks like mission control center for selling time share. The sales staff are everywhere like vultures.
The room and the resort itself was very nice, but a bit dated and the pool was very nice, but only opens from 10 to 6 which is not long enough for people who goes to the parks for most of the day and want to relax for a while by the pool.

When I booked this hotel for our vacation in Disney, I was very concerned that Liki Tiki Village was not going to be what I expected for the price and because of some of the comments people wrote. Well, IGNORE the bad comments people are writing. I made sure that we have booked an efficiency in one of the newer buildings and it was far much nicer than what we expected. Granite in the kitchen and bathrooms, plasma tv's and very clean. The front desk staff was very nice upon arrival and there was no nagging about going on a tour of the place. They have 3 pool areas, one being the water park, and the other 2 you can relax and sunbathe. It is only 7 miles from Disney but allow yourself 20-30 minutes to travel because of morning traffic. The pools are heated. Very nice place for themoney!!
